Output 32e5bb2d73045f285221da5e59d29c805f178c2ffad7f8ac12ce8982cbf5929f:1

value
665699
script pubkey
OP_0 OP_PUSHBYTES_20 23cf63f2d21edf14d1bce85a08c961aef42fad50
address
tb1qy08k8ukjrm03f5duapdq3jtp4m6zlt2stxug4u
transaction
32e5bb2d73045f285221da5e59d29c805f178c2ffad7f8ac12ce8982cbf5929f
confirmations
100031
spent
true